我正在评估代码格式化的新包装/对齐功能。
只有当代码超过120个字符时才能包装代码。
选项“Wrap long lines”设置为120,但似乎不起作用。
PS。我来自resharper营地,但是在大型项目上我需要寻找替代品,这是非常痛苦的。
答案 0 :(得分:1)
“Wrap long lines”选项包装长度超过选项值的代码行。但是,在当前实现中它不包装语句。这意味着它将包装长条件,具有长名称的标识符等,但不包括位于单行上的语句。好消息是,CodeRush的下一个主要版本将允许您包装任何超出选项值的代码(例如120个字符)。要使当前选项有效,请打开“换行长行”选项并将列的大小设置为首选值。然后,转到常规格式选项并启用“在autoformat上调整代码样式”选项 - 这将允许您使用Visual Studio格式(例如Edit-> Advanced)使用“Wrap long lines”选项重新格式化代码 - >格式文档,CTRL + E,D)。